Can you cook eggs at night and eat them in the morning?

Scrambled eggs can be made the night before and easily warmed in a microwave for breakfast the next day. Cooking eggs for the next day doesn’t mean eating cold scrambled eggs. It saves you time in the morning, while still providing home-cooked breakfast..

How long are scrambled eggs good for in the fridge?

Scrambled eggs or cooked eggs that have been made into egg salad or a quiche should be refrigerated and eaten within 3 to 4 days. Hard-boiled eggs will last for a full week if stored unpeeled in the fridge.

How do you store cooked scrambled eggs?

Scrambled eggs are easy to freeze, and they taste great when reheated! We like to cook them so they’re slightly runny, which helps them retain a soft texture when they’re warmed through. Let your scrambled eggs fully cool before packing them into individual portions in freezer-safe bags.

Can you eat an omelette the next day? It is safe to eat an omelet the next day as long as it did not sit out for more than 2 hours at room temperature. Cooked omelets can be stored in the fridge for up to 4 days or frozen for up to 4 months. They should be stored in an airtight container or ziplock bag.

Can you eat leftover eggs?

Eggs, and dishes that contain eggs like quiches and casseroles, should be served shortly after they have been cooked. If you don’t plan to serve them immediately, the FDA recommends refrigerating and reheating the dish to a temperature of 165 degrees Fahrenheit before you dig in.

What happens if you eat bad scrambled eggs?

If a person has any doubt about whether an egg has gone bad, they should throw it out. The main risk of eating bad eggs is Salmonella infection, which can cause diarrhea, vomiting, and fever.

Are scrambled eggs good reheated in the microwave? Reheating scrambled eggs in hot water is the safest way to ensure you don’t overcook them, but it’s not the fastest. The microwave was fast and can work okay on low power. The stove also works fine if you use low heat, but both methods will cook your eggs slightly.

Can you keep cooked eggs in the fridge?

Information. Hard cooked eggs can be stored in the refrigerator up to seven days, either left in their shells or peeled. Make sure eggs are refrigerated within two hours after cooking, and don’t leave refrigerated cooked eggs out at room temperature for more than two hours.

How do you keep scrambled eggs warm for a buffet?

First things first, if you are going to hold your eggs in a low oven, place your oven-safe egg bowl in your oven and turn it as low as it goes, usually between 150-200, as soon as you hit the kitchen. The bowl will warm so that it will help keep the eggs a good temp, even once you put it on the table or buffet.
